Roger JamesDUNNAfter a long battle with Cancer, Roger finally passed away peacefully in the arms of his eternally devoted wife Val and his proud sons Dominic and Jamie. His family's sorrow will never outweigh the immense pride they feel at what an incredibly brave man Roger was. Funeral service to take place on Tuesday, May 12 at 12 noon in St. Peter and St. Paul's Church, Stainton prior to cremation at Teesside Crematorium in the Chapel of St. Hilda at 1.15p.m. Friends please meet at church and afterwards at the Stainton. Family flowers only please, donations, if so desired, to Cancer Research, a collection plate will be available at church.
